The public middle schools with the highest share of Black students in Missoula County, Montana

This ranking covers the public middle schools with the highest share of Black students in Missoula County, Montana, drawn from 9 qualifying public middle schools. Porter Middle School leads the list at 3.6%, against a median of 1.0% across the ranked schools.
